📅  最后修改于: 2023-12-03 14:43:19.176000             🧑  作者: Mango
在使用jQuery时,选择多个类的元素是很常见的操作。本文将介绍如何使用jQuery选择两个类。
jQuery选择器通过CSS选择器实现,与CSS类选择器一样,可以选择多个类。使用多个类选择器,只需要将类名连在一起即可。例如:
$(".class1.class2")
以上代码将选择同时包含class1
和class2
的元素。
除了使用多个类选择器,还可以使用class选择器和过滤选择器结合使用。例如:
$(".class1").filter(".class2")
以上代码将选择包含class1
和class2
的元素。使用过滤选择器可以更精确地选择元素。
下面是一个示例代码,演示如何使用jQuery选择两个类:
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>jQuery选择2个类 - JavaScript</title>
<script src="https://cdn.bootcdn.net/ajax/libs/jquery/3.5.1/jquery.min.js"></script>
</head>
<body>
<div class="class1"></div>
<div class="class1 class2"></div>
<div class="class2"></div>
<script>
// 使用多个类选择器选择元素
var elements1 = $(".class1.class2");
console.log(elements1.length); // 输出 1
// 使用class选择器和过滤选择器选择元素
var elements2 = $(".class1").filter(".class2");
console.log(elements2.length); // 输出 1
</script>
</body>
</html>
以上代码将输出1
,表示选择到了一个元素。
以上就是如何使用jQuery选择两个类的介绍。除了使用多个类选择器和过滤选择器,jQuery还提供了更多强大的选择器功能,可以根据不同的需求选择元素。学习jQuery选择器是成为优秀前端开发人员的一个必备知识点。